Just saw Fantasia and Fantasia 2000 (told to watch by Isibata-sensei). First off... The original Fantasia... WHAT THE HELL IS THAT FROM 1940?! *Goes to cry in a dark corner* No seriously... nevermind the quality of animation that's so.... Disney quality, the harmony and synch with the orchestra symphony was something I took note of too. I've seen some sequences of it as a kid (dancing elephants, hippos and crocs being one of em), long forgotten so kinda mentally squealed upon seeing my old favorites~ The bad thing about the original was that it was so darn LONG. Over 2 hours and some sequences were a tad too slow (almost nod off to sleep). But that was definitely something that I could pick out lots of tips from. Now the 2000 remake of Fantasia... The 3D flying whale sequence (The Pines of Rome) was nice in all, but why in the world did they have to use 3D for the characters? Somehow, just somehow the 'natural' feel of them that could've been animated using Disney's fantastic, traditional 2D animation, but no.... 3D animation just looks too.... perfect. I'm biased against 3D animation (ESPECIALLY when it comes to creature/ human characters *fumes & stamps on the word 3D*) because of that very fact. Of course, Disney has to be given a lot of credit for trying their best to make their 3D whales look as natural as possible, but I could STILL feel the flawed perfection (<-- does that even make sense...). It might've been so much better if they stuck to 2D animation. Oh. And as usual, Disney's natural backgrounds = O_________O. 3 pieces I like best : 'The Pines of Rome' (I like the idea of flying whales & the backgrounds were absolutely stunning aside from my grudge against the 3D animated characters), 'The Carnival of Animals' (pure entertainment with a bunch of musical flamingoes + yoyos~, I liked that particular piece of music too), and 'The Firebird' (Now THIS... this is the kind of animation that wants to make me land up at Disney. Unfortunately, there are far more kiddish cartoons I wouldn't want to do, overshadowing it). The last one, 'The Firebird' certainly made the closing of Fantasia all the more magical (I'm a sucker for this sort of story, me being me). Visually appealling, and will leave a lot of jaws on the ground~

That aside, *rips own hair out* I've got plenty to think about now that I've finally seen those 2 animations. Translation of everything said in the trailer:

Opening words:

錬金術。
何かを得るためには同等の代価を支払うという
「等価交換の原則」に
基づいて物質を作り変えること

Alchemy:
In order to gain something, another of the same value must be paid / sacrificed
to change the very material of things by
'the law of equivalent exchange'.




鋼の錬金術師;シャンバラを征く者

Fullmetal Alchemist : The movie




Narration:

「そこは、魔術と錬金術の戦場。。。
引き裂かれた二人の兄弟。。。」

"There lies the battlefield of magic and alchemy.
2 brothers torn from each other..."




Alphonse Heiderich:

「信じてた、兄さんは何処かに生きてるって」

"I believed... that (big) brother is alive somewhere out there..."




Narration:

「彼等の痛みは何を得るの代価だったのか?」

"What was the pain of their seperation in exchange for?"




Edward Elric:

「何処まで往っても、ここから逃げられない」

"No matter where (I) go, (I) can't get out of here..."




Narration:

「そして、二人の錬金術は、世界を救えるのか?
劇場版、 鋼の錬金術師;シャンバラを征く者」

"And... can the alchemy of the 2 save the world?
Fullmetal Alchemist the movie; Conqueror of Shambala"




Ending words:

二人の約束の日、世界は動く

On their / the two's promised day, the world will move...


===============================

My apologies if some lines sound weird... I didn't want to compromise the accuracy of direct translation...

Fullmetal Alchemist: Conqueror of Shambala

The 2nd phase of pre-release ticket sales will start in Japan on the 26th of March (Saturday). This time, any ticket purchase will include a postcard set (view picture here). Stock is limited. Price of tickets: 1.300 yen for adults, 800 yen for children (below secondary education).

Note: The first phase included a swing holder set.

Sources
Official movie homepage -- link (jpn)
